Protractor
Protractor is a test framework for Angular and AngularJS applications. Protractor executes tests against your application running in a real browser, which ensures correctness and trustworthiness of test results. JetBrains Rider integrates with Protractor so you can run and debug your tests from inside the IDE. You can see the test results in a treeview and easily navigate to the test source from there.
Installing Protractor
You can install Protractor locally, in your project, or globally. Global installation is preferable.
To install Protractor globally
Open the built-in JetBrains Rider Terminal (Ctrl+Alt+1) and type
npm install -g protractor
at the command prompt.
To download the necessary binaries, type
webdriver-manager update
. See also Getting Started on the Protractor official website.
Running tests
Protractor tests are launched only through a run/debug configuration.
To create a Protractor run configuration
Open the Run/Debug Configuration dialog box ( on the main menu). Click on the toolbar and select Protractor from the list. The Run/Debug Configuration: Protractor dialog box opens.
Specify the Node.js interpreter to use. This can be a local Node.js interpreter or a Node.js on Windows Subsystem for Linux.
Specify the location of the
protractor
package and the path to theprotractor.conf.js
configuration file. If you followed the standard installation, JetBrains Rider detects all these paths and displays them in the corresponding fields.

Debugging tests
A debugging session for Protractor tests is started only through a run/debug configuration.
To start debugging tests
Create a Protractor run/debug configuration as described above.
Select the Protractor run/debug configuration from the list on the main toolbar and click to the right of the list.
In the Debug window that opens, proceed as usual: step through the tests, stop and resume test execution, examine the test when suspended, etc.
